Re: [rfc-i] Poll: RFCs with page numbers (pretty please) ?

Brian E Carpenter <brian.e.carpenter@gmail.com> Wed, 28 October 2020 02:27 UTC

Return-Path: <rfc-interest-bounces@rfc-editor.org>
X-Original-To: ietfarch-rfc-interest-archive@ietfa.amsl.com
Delivered-To: ietfarch-rfc-interest-archive@ietfa.amsl.com
Received: from localhost (localhost [127.0.0.1]) by ietfa.amsl.com (Postfix) with ESMTP id 240943A0C1F; Tue, 27 Oct 2020 19:27:31 -0700 (PDT)
X-Virus-Scanned: amavisd-new at amsl.com
X-Spam-Flag: NO
X-Spam-Score: -2.445
X-Spam-Level:
X-Spam-Status: No, score=-2.445 tagged_above=-999 required=5 tests=[BAYES_00=-1.9, DKIM_ADSP_CUSTOM_MED=0.001, DKIM_INVALID=0.1, DKIM_SIGNED=0.1, FREEMAIL_FORGED_FROMDOMAIN=0.25, FREEMAIL_FROM=0.001, HEADER_FROM_DIFFERENT_DOMAINS=0.25, MAILING_LIST_MULTI=-1, NICE_REPLY_A=-0.247, SPF_PASS=-0.001, URIBL_BLOCKED=0.001] autolearn=ham autolearn_force=no
Authentication-Results: ietfa.amsl.com (amavisd-new); dkim=fail (2048-bit key) reason="fail (message has been altered)" header.d=gmail.com
Received: from mail.ietf.org ([4.31.198.44]) by localhost (ietfa.amsl.com [127.0.0.1]) (amavisd-new, port 10024) with ESMTP id HYXCMSdFX7ae; Tue, 27 Oct 2020 19:27:28 -0700 (PDT)
Received: from rfc-editor.org (rfc-editor.org [4.31.198.49]) (using TLSv1.2 with cipher AECDH-AES256-SHA (256/256 bits)) (No client certificate requested) by ietfa.amsl.com (Postfix) with ESMTPS id A16DE3A0C36; Tue, 27 Oct 2020 19:27:28 -0700 (PDT)
Received: from rfcpa.amsl.com (localhost [IPv6:::1]) by rfc-editor.org (Postfix) with ESMTP id D6127F40710; Tue, 27 Oct 2020 19:27:15 -0700 (PDT)
X-Original-To: rfc-interest@rfc-editor.org
Delivered-To: rfc-interest@rfc-editor.org
Received: from localhost (localhost [127.0.0.1]) by rfc-editor.org (Postfix) with ESMTP id 60A0CF40710 for <rfc-interest@rfc-editor.org>; Tue, 27 Oct 2020 19:27:14 -0700 (PDT)
X-Virus-Scanned: amavisd-new at rfc-editor.org
Authentication-Results: rfcpa.amsl.com (amavisd-new); dkim=pass (2048-bit key) header.d=gmail.com
Received: from rfc-editor.org ([127.0.0.1]) by localhost (rfcpa.amsl.com [127.0.0.1]) (amavisd-new, port 10024) with ESMTP id f8zKWJuiLkBA for <rfc-interest@rfc-editor.org>; Tue, 27 Oct 2020 19:27:09 -0700 (PDT)
Received: from mail-pf1-x42a.google.com (mail-pf1-x42a.google.com [IPv6:2607:f8b0:4864:20::42a]) by rfc-editor.org (Postfix) with ESMTPS id 38541F4070E for <rfc-interest@rfc-editor.org>; Tue, 27 Oct 2020 19:27:09 -0700 (PDT)
Received: by mail-pf1-x42a.google.com with SMTP id 126so2047450pfu.4 for <rfc-interest@rfc-editor.org>; Tue, 27 Oct 2020 19:27:20 -0700 (PDT)
D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=gmail.com; s=20161025; h=subject:to:cc:references:from:message-id:date:user-agent :mime-version:in-reply-to:content-language:content-transfer-encoding; bh=2lGhep3Bbq69Ugn2B5NIN9NkSq9wW1kmNDAYJuI+DII=; b=EhGu9Z7zDnYvaAvs0kURXTlULuIhM2608XceCOQGVLcAudldJbwIcPQlf+tivc7O3/ WrlIK5+wNNPJypecq+23Qq+D0ESsU4THNFa/gJqXihoONoa3PvmH+O+lytlhIH5xwU2k IHEsy5nq1ziYExguEHa7r8IE6Si36fe/ihIEJ8VvZ67iS4YnBRIodPKTSAUpQKbdr/vd HCeapq5yGTrApawxtApPci/92b2FIDiPmQ3zNVUUMCPcORUc+Zg1+B04sh61ViZRrbFP AL0zwzb7K582RTkjG2v+k4GxTD7MJCg50KSObWEb0CCWU5lQARDNgJf1mXMejx7j6JCq lD4g==
X-Google-D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=1e100.net; s=20161025; h=x-gm-message-state:subject:to:cc:references:from:message-id:date :user-agent:mime-version:in-reply-to:content-language :content-transfer-encoding; bh=2lGhep3Bbq69Ugn2B5NIN9NkSq9wW1kmNDAYJuI+DII=; b=OgbzdTGvNXLxC/yX2ItGYMkhLsqgq7u2PQm2tfem/LLzjiueCjHu+0E2qpzCdnfuQ5 OM5EI0YkQLrfxjxPcvWGrcZa9FbtT/JsWltJEHUgmICvk7PSlqFSegvNZkT5IfzsyjZy YcPjzt4EIzGhj2dYnDUc4oAT11AzL/K7RTD/kcE1TnIrwVLiNtU+XsIfGyV3QJxk9q5O AsgfAg5Yj1GtmCrZIY5Sx0U60hfKB2vNTf4LsCYQxEtNsyPMUA3qA+n34MgcxSGZ5PpE 8z9cIHY6JsnerFG1aNONpoR6Z1kpDdoSdVtW6rxmMv7pkV2+J59lYuIAYZTQ2gziV5ub 36aA==
X-Gm-Message-State: AOAM530nr0c+zv/VQR8rfgW0JRD0q6Lt+3V5tuXn0kZJAQn7FeT16vKq m4Px9ZpmVI/wFyE9y7jfICg=
X-Google-Smtp-Source: ABdhPJz9WBlhdUYd8LM8JIWEoDwB+c42RIgGxbqOnuW8XG25da/6VeH/OSCbFjDLPsEUTYe7WEBjnA==
X-Received: by 2002:a62:158c:0:b029:152:6669:ac75 with SMTP id 134-20020a62158c0000b02901526669ac75mr5077677pfv.5.1603852040461; Tue, 27 Oct 2020 19:27:20 -0700 (PDT)
Received: from [192.168.178.20] ([151.210.130.0]) by smtp.gmail.com with ESMTPSA id r8sm3420308pgl.57.2020.10.27.19.27.16 (version=TLS1_2 cipher=ECDHE-ECDSA-AES128-GCM-SHA256 bits=128/128); Tue, 27 Oct 2020 19:27:19 -0700 (PDT)
To: John Scudder <jgs@juniper.net>, Ted Lemon <mellon@fugue.com>
References: <20201026020433.GA19475@faui48f.informatik.uni-erlangen.de> <CADaq8je8gMwAkOndTNJ9ndwzOZb2HQMZrCUJ5wNUjw-6ax9QtA@mail.gmail.com> <35EFE952-7786-4E24-B228-9BEE51D3C876@tzi.org> <20201026150241.GK48111@faui48f.informatik.uni-erlangen.de> <20201026162814.GP39170@kduck.mit.edu> <20201026164036.GO48111@faui48f.informatik.uni-erlangen.de> <1a56dc3b-56ef-3ffb-a12b-44d5e0d0f835@levkowetz.com> <20201026171931.GP48111@faui48f.informatik.uni-erlangen.de> <b733240-fc78-5a71-8920-ff84fbf64287@iecc.com> <20201026180105.GQ48111@faui48f.informatik.uni-erlangen.de> <03976f9f-7f49-7bf7-ce29-ee989232a44d@gmail.com> <7FA8EF59-5CDE-42B9-A487-520531EEA1F0@juniper.net> <m2sg9z1seh.wl-randy@psg.com> <3DC65259-20A7-4AFA-BC24-604AB184081E@fugue.com> <7AEF79AB-8CDF-4414-BBB8-D1EA9716F82F@juniper.net>
From: Brian E Carpenter <brian.e.carpenter@gmail.com>
Message-ID: <14b4cde5-957a-8eda-bd10-98d7e4674af2@gmail.com>
Date: Wed, 28 Oct 2020 15:27:15 +1300
User-Agent: Mozilla/5.0 (Windows NT 10.0; WOW64; rv:60.0) Gecko/20100101 Thunderbird/60.9.1
MIME-Version: 1.0
In-Reply-To: <7AEF79AB-8CDF-4414-BBB8-D1EA9716F82F@juniper.net>
Content-Language: en-US
Subject: Re: [rfc-i] Poll: RFCs with page numbers (pretty please) ?
X-BeenThere: rfc-interest@rfc-editor.org
X-Mailman-Version: 2.1.29
Precedence: list
List-Id: "A list for discussion of the RFC series and RFC Editor functions." <rfc-interest.rfc-editor.org>
List-Unsubscribe: <https://www.rfc-editor.org/mailman/options/rfc-interest>, <mailto:rfc-interest-request@rfc-editor.org?subject=unsubscribe>
List-Archive: <http://www.rfc-editor.org/pipermail/rfc-interest/>
List-Post: <mailto:rfc-interest@rfc-editor.org>
List-Help: <mailto:rfc-interest-request@rfc-editor.org?subject=help>
List-Subscribe: <https://www.rfc-editor.org/mailman/listinfo/rfc-interest>, <mailto:rfc-interest-request@rfc-editor.org?subject=subscribe>
Cc: "rfc-interest@rfc-editor.org" <rfc-interest@rfc-editor.org>, "rsoc@iab.org" <rsoc@iab.org>, IETF Rinse Repeat <ietf@ietf.org>
Content-Type: text/plain; charset="utf-8"
Content-Transfer-Encoding: base64
Errors-To: rfc-interest-bounces@rfc-editor.org
Sender: rfc-interest <rfc-interest-bounces@rfc-editor.org>

On 28-Oct-20 06:54, John Scudder wrote:
> As a reminder for those who have lost track, this thread was kicked off by Toerless saying he would like to be able to render his own copies to include a useful table of contents, for his own use, at home, probably with the blinds drawn to keep the world from witnessing his shame. A little while later Henrik said in no uncertain terms that adding the capability to xml2rfc would be trivial, and that he’d be happy to do it, but that he was specifically directed not to do so.

Not speaking for anybody except myself, I'll simply observe that the tools people were asked to go and implement the RFCs that were published after a public comment period (as Robert pointed out), and one of those RFCs specified a txt format without page numbers. So that's what got done. Not everybody agreed with that choice at the time, and evidently not everyone agrees with it now, but it wasn't decided in secret.

> So far, nobody has even attempted to justify this directive, although a zoo of straw men has been paraded through the subsequent follow ups. 

The directive was "please implement the RFCs". If I understand correctly, that was budgetted and paid for. As far as I can see there's nothing in those RFCs that even purports to forbid other formats being generated, but there *is* a rational argument against page numbers that's been made here, and the same argument applies against line numbers. If you want something more precise than section numbers, the only portable one I can envisage is paragraph numbers. That has a good chance of working across all formats.

   Brian
 
> —John
> 
>> On Oct 27, 2020, at 1:42 PM, Ted Lemon <mellon@fugue.com> wrote:
>>
>> [External Email. Be cautious of content]
>>
>>
>> You’re perfectly allowed. Use enscript, or whatever pagination tool you want. The issue is not that you aren’t allowed—it’s that if the IETF provides a pagination tool, we will be perceived as having provided page numbers, and those page numbers may then be used when referencing documents. By making you take the step of paginating, we avoid that worry.
>>
>> Of course, if your goal is just to be annoyed at dem kids, please continue… :)
>>
>>>>> On Oct 27, 2020, at 1:37 PM, Randy Bush <randy@psg.com> wrote:
>>>>> The argument that page numbers are harmful for *any* *purpose*
>>>>> *whatever* is not reasonable. ... A table of contents, in short.
>>> <doh>  no can do.  might make document more useful. </snark>
>>> and if you drop it on the floor, you can put it in the card sorter.  oh
>>> wait.  :)
>>> what i find shocking here is the "we know best, and you will not be
>>> allowed attitude," an authoritarianism which seems to have become
>>> more and more popular.
>>> randy, going back under my rock
>>> _______________________________________________
>>> rfc-interest mailing list
>>> rfc-interest@rfc-editor.org
>>> https://urldefense.com/v3/__https://www.rfc-editor.org/mailman/listinfo/rfc-interest__;!!NEt6yMaO-gk!VIhQWQApr4DvECYK83EOx4p68Kxuixee5QgwjzWjYc2kt0IuDGK6SspEWifMgQ$
> _______________________________________________
> rfc-interest mailing list
> rfc-interest@rfc-editor.org
> https://www.rfc-editor.org/mailman/listinfo/rfc-interest
> 

_______________________________________________
rfc-interest mailing list
rfc-interest@rfc-editor.org
https://www.rfc-editor.org/mailman/listinfo/rfc-interest